Sally Ross


Birthday
01/29/2026
thingson.tv Credits
2

Filmography

The Witcher: Blood Origin poster
The Witcher: Blood Origin

Art Department Coordinator

Lara Croft: Tomb Raider poster
Lara Croft: Tomb Raider

Visual Effects Coordinator